Rice Krispie Chocolate Chip Cookies

Step 1: Preheat & Prep

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line baking s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ats.

Step 2: Cream the Butter & Sugars

  1. Cream together soft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y (about 2-3 minutes).

Step 3: Add Wet Ingredients

  1. Add eggs one at a time, mixing well. Stir in vanilla extract.

Step 4: Combine Dry Ingredients

  1. Whisk together fl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.
  2. Gradually add dry ingredients to wet ingredients, mixing on low speed until just combined.

Step 5: Fold in Cereal & Chips

  1. Gently fold in Rice Krispies and chocolate chips until evenly distributed.

Step 6: Bake the Cookies

  1. Drop by rounded tablespoons onto prepared baking sheets, leaving 2 inches between cookies.
  2.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until edges are golden and centers are set.
  3. Cool on baking sheets for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Cooking Tips & Notes

  • Use softened, not melted, butter for best results.
  • Don’t overmix the dough after adding dry ingredients to prevent tough cookies.
  • Let cookies cool slightly on the baking sheet before transferring to prevent breakage.
  •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week.

Variations

  • White Chocolate: Substitute semi-sweet chocolate chips with white chocolate chips.
  • Peanut Butter Crunch: Add 1/2 cup creamy peanut butter and 1/2 cup chopped peanuts.
  • Butterscotch Delight: Replace half the chocolate chips with butterscotch chips.
  • Marshmallow Treat: Add 1 cup mini marshmallows.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Can I Use Salted Butter?

Yes, reduce the added salt to 1/4 teaspoon.

How Do I Keep Cookies Soft?

Store in an airtight container with a slice of bread.

Can I Freeze the Dough?

Yes, freeze in portions, then bake from frozen (add 1-2 minutes to baking time).

Can I Use Different Cereal?

Experiment with Cornflakes or Cheerios!
